Tony Blair is on The Daily Show with Jon Stewart talking about his new book, A Journey: My Political Life (Knopf, ISBN 978-0307269836). PW’s review said, “Critics who dubbed Britain’s ex-prime minister “Tony Blur” for his allegedly substance-free politics swaddled in gauzy PR won’t have their minds changed by this nebulous memoir.”

The Colbert Report talks with Sean Wilentz, author of Bob Dylan in America (Doubleday, ISBN 978-0385529884).

The Today Show learns how to Live Like a Hot Chick (Avon Trade, ISBN 978-0061959073) when it sits down with author Jodi Lipper.

Charlie Rose discusses Working Together: Why Great Partnerships Succeed (Harper Business, ISBN 978-0061732362) with Michael Eisner.

Katherine Schwarzenegger chats up The View on the occasion of the publication of her new book. Rock What You’ve Got: Secrets to Loving Your Inner and Outer Beauty from Someone Who's Been There and Back (Voice, ISBN 978-1401341435).

Good Morning America gets political today, featuring Making Our Democracy Work: A Judge’s View by Stephen Breyer (Knopf, ISBN 978-0307269911) and Pinheads and Patriots: Where You Stand in the Age of Obama by Bill O'Reilly (Morrow, ISBN 978-0061950711).
